How much do software ass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for software assistant in La Crosse, WI is $26.12,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.62 and $29.24 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a software assistant?

Software Assistants are digital tools or programs designed to help users accomplish specific tasks or streamline workflows within software environments. They can range from simple task automation bots to advanced AI-driven virtual assistants that provide support, suggestions, or information. These assistants often integrate with various applications to enhance productivity and reduce manual effort. Examples include voice-activated assistants, chatbots, and scheduling tools. Their main goal is to make using complex software easier and more efficient for users.

How does a software assistant typically collaborate with software engineers and other team members in a development project?

A Software Assistant often works closely with software engineers, project managers, and QA specialists to support the software development lifecycle. They may assist by managing documentation, tracking bugs or feature requests, preparing reports, and helping coordinate meetings or schedules. Effective communication and organization are key, as the Software Assistant often acts as a bridge between technical and non-technical team members to ensure projects run smoothly. This role provides valuable exposure to various aspects of software development and can be a stepping stone to more specialized technical roles.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a software assistant?

To thrive as a Software Assistant, you need foundational knowledge of software applications, troubleshooting, and basic programming concepts, often supported by a relevant degree or technical certification. Familiarity with help desk software, ticketing systems, and common productivity tools like Microsoft Office or Google Workspace is typically required. Strong communication, problem-solving abilities, and a customer-focused attitude help you effectively support users and resolve issues. These skills ensure efficient technical support, smooth user experiences, and contribute to overall organizational productivity.
